Newcomer Integration and Settlement Support
Adapting to a new country or community can often feel challenging and overwhelming. Newcomers often face challenges related to language, employment, and understanding unfamiliar systems. Through its newcomer assistance initiatives, W.A.Y. Community Services Centre provides structured guidance that helps individuals and families integrate successfully into their new environments.
The organisation delivers cultural orientation sessions, settlement support, and language guidance aimed at helping newcomers understand community services and build essential life skills. Individuals accessing services from a Community Services Centre in Brampton or surrounding regions receive guidance on education, employment pathways, and social services. This approach enables newcomers to build confidence while creating a strong foundation for long-term success in their communities.
